Democracy is based on the priciple of political equality, on recognising that the poorest and the least educated has the same status as the rich and the educated. People are not subjects of a ruler, they are the rulers themselves. even when they make mistakes, they are responsible for their conduct Hence, Democracy enhances the dignity of a citizen.

Democracy enhances the dignity of citizens by giving them a voice in the governance of their society through the ability to vote and participate in decision-making processes. It promotes equality and respect for individuals by ensuring that laws and policies are made with the consent of the governed. Additionally, democracy allows for the protection of fundamental rights and freedoms that contribute to a sense of autonomy and self-worth among citizens.
